We are looking for a real estate research assistant. This person will take a list of properties provided and do a thorough background check on all of the properties. This includes (but is not limited to):
-Going on county websites to pull information from the county and calling the county when information isn't available online.
-Pulling the property cards and finding if any liens are on the properties
-Gathering information from websites like
-Taking screen shots of google maps and other websites for research purposes
-Researching what schools/crime/surroundings are for a property
-Finding comparable recently sold properties in the area
All information will be stored in excel spreadsheets and links will need to be added to the excel workbook for reference.
We will train someone to do this and provide the list of websites where we want information gathered so it's not like we will give a blank spreadsheet and not help. However we need someone who is able to quickly gather information off the internet and provide a fast turn around on the lists.
A successful person will be able to be consistent, return information correctly and quickly, and be able to problem solve when information isn't where it's expected to be.
